Starting January 1, students can begin applying for scholarships for the 2022-2023 Academic Year through Central Kentucky Community Foundation’s Scholarship Central. The application deadline for scholarships is March 1. You may register anytime on Scholarship Central.
All scholarship applications in Scholarship Central require the following documentation:
- Official transcript – provided by academic counselor
- ACT and/or SAT scores – provided by academic counselor
- Copy of your full Student Aid Report (SAR) when you complete the FAFSA (fafsa.ed.gov) – uploaded by applicant

Some scholarships require additional documentation, which is listed on each application. Scholarship applicants must meet specific criteria for each scholarship. Award amounts and the number of awards are estimates and are subject to change from year to year.
Scholarship recipients will be announced at Celebrating Achievement, an annual awards dinner each year at the end of April.All recipients will be notified by email.
Most scholarships are for one academic year, but we offer some renewable scholarships as well.
